原文:C语言中链表任意位置怎么插入数据?然后写入文件中?

链表插入示意图: 图是个人所画 因为链表指针指来指去,难以理解,所以辅助画图更加方便。 插入某个学号后面图: 定义的结构体: 插入到某个学号后面,但不能插入到第一个节点的前面 任意位置插入图: 代码这么一改,任意位置的插入: ...

2015-09-04 13:53 0 3523 推荐指数:

查看详情

C语言中怎么将文件里的数据创建到(读到)链表

定义的结构体: 创建文件写入文件信息: 这里值得注意的是:写入文件的时候,开始时要事先写入第一个数据,这里写入的空数据,这与链表head处数据为空有关。 从已经写入文件读到链表: 从链表输出打印到屏幕 ...

Thu Sep 03 23:35:00 CST 2015 1 9995
数据结构:单链表 头尾插入,头尾删除,任意位置插入任意位置删除

本小结中心思想   主要是为了深入理解链表和熟练的对链表操作,在定义count时一定要初始化,即:int count = 0;。 头结点和尾结点 1 在链表任意位置 插入结点的操作要把头结点和尾结点拿出来单独讨论   假设头结点的位置为1,例如,链表数据:39 99 2 5 10 ...

Wed Sep 04 01:19:00 CST 2019 0 706
C语言中文件的读取和写入

注意: 1、由于C是缓冲写 所以要在关闭或刷新后才能看到文件内容 2、电脑处理文本型和二进制型的不同 (因为电脑只认识二进制格式) 在C语言中文件C语言中文件 ...

Fri Oct 05 20:23:00 CST 2012 1 108684
c语言中链表

线性结构:有且只有一个根节点,且每个节点最多有一个直接前驱和一个直接后继的非空数据结构 非线性结构:不满足线性结构的数据结构 链表(单向链表的建立、删除、插入、打印) 1、链表一般分为:    单向链表 双向链表 环形链表 2、基本概念 链表实际上 ...

Fri Dec 04 20:00:00 CST 2020 0 407
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M